Baba Siddique, a veteran Indian politician and former Maharashtra minister, met a tragic end when he was shot dead in Mumbai’s Bandra East area on Saturday night. The incident occurred outside his son Zeeshan Siddiqui’s office, where three assailants fired six rounds at him, striking him four times in the stomach and chest .
The police have arrested two accused, Karnil Singh from Haryana and Dharamraj Kashyap from Uttar Pradesh, while a third suspect remains at large . According to reports, the arrested shooters have links to the Lawrence Bishnoi gang, which is a significant lead in the investigation .
There are multiple motives being explored, including a dispute over a resettlement project for slum dwellers and contract killing . Baba Siddique had received threats before, but Mumbai Police denied receiving any official letter from him regarding these threats .
